Quilts (床罩) are a narrative art; with themes that are political, spiritual, communal, or commemorative, they are infused with history and memory, mapping out intimate stories and legacies through a handcrafted language of design. Handstitched Worlds: The Cartography of Quilts is an invitation to read quilts as maps, tracing the paths of individual histories that illuminate larger historic events and cultural trends.
Spanning the nineteenth to twenty-first centuries, this insightful and engaging exhibition brings together 18 quilts from the collection of the American Folk Art Museum, New York, representing a range of materials, motifs, and techniques from traditional early-American quilts to more contemporary sculptural assemblages. The quilts in Handstitched Worlds show us how this too-often overlooked medium balances creativity with tradition, individuality with collective zeitgeist. Like a road map, these unique works offer a path to a deeper understanding of the American cultural fabric.

2 . The history of microbiology begins with Dutch cloth maker named Antoni van Leeuwenhoek, a man of no formal scientific education. In the late 1600s. Leeuwenhoek, inspired by the magnifying lenses(放大镜)he used to examine cloth, built some of the first-microscopes. He developed technique to improve the quality of tiny, rounded lenses, some of which could magnify an object up to 270 times. After removing some plaque from between his teeth and examining it under a lens, Leeuwenhoek found tiny twisting creatures, which he called “animalcules”.
His observations, which he reported to the Royal Society of London, are among the first descriptions of microbes(微生物). Leeuwenhoek discovered an entire universe invisible to the human eye. He found different microbes in samples of pond water, rain water, and human blood. He gave the first description of red blood cells, observed plant tissue, examined muscle, and investigated the life cycle of insects.
Nearly two hundred years later, Leeuwenhock’s discovery of microbes helped French chemist and biologist Louis Pasteur to develop his “theory of disease”. This concept suggested that disease originates from tiny organisms attacking and weakening the body. Pasteur’s theory later helped doctors to fight infectious diseases including anthrax, diphtheria, polio, smallpox, tetanus, and typhoid. All these breakthroughs were the result of Leeuwenhoek’s original work. Leeuwenhoek did not foresee this legacy.
In a 1716 letter, he described his contribution to science this way: “My work, which I’ve done for a long time, was not pursued in order to gain the praise I now enjoy, but chiefly from a strong desire for knowledge, which I notice resides in me more than in most other men. And therefore; whenever I found out anything remarkable, I have thought it my duty to put down my discovery on paper, so that the scientific community might be informed thereof.”

3 . Mathew White, an environmental psychologist, is on a mission to give Mother Nature the respect he thinks she deserves when it comes to human health. For decades, scientists and health-care professionals have recognized that exposure to green spaces, such as public parks or forests, is linked with lower risks of all sorts of illnesses common in the world. Experimental work has demonstrated various physiological responses that occur when people spend time in natural environments: blood pressure drops, heart rate decreases, immune function improves, and the nervous system directs the body to rest and digest.
As humans increasingly populate urbanized areas, they are spending less and less time in natural environments. But before doctors can start advising their patients to head to the nearest park, there is an important outstanding question, says White: How much time in nature do you need to generate these apparent benefits? Most of the research that has linked health outcomes with exposure to the natural world didn’t use frequency or duration of park visits, but rather the amount of green space within a certain distance of a person’s home, White says. But “it’s not so much where you live; it’s whether you use it or not.”
So he collected data to estimate what dose(剂量) of nature was needed to show benefits to a person’s health. White’s group found the answer he was after: Spending at least two hours in nature per week was strongly correlated with self-reports of being in good health or having high wellbeing. “I was very surprised, to be honest,” says White, who had been expecting a much longer time. “We had no idea that such a clear threshold of time per week would emerge from the data.”
He was further surprised to learn that it didn’t seem to matter how many trips to a park people took, so long as they got in their two hours per week. It could be a long visit one day, a couple of hour-long trips, three visits of 40 minutes, or four half-hour excursions. He and his colleagues speculate that, if nature’s apparent health benefits are a result of being able to de-stress, then whatever pattern of green space exposure fits one’s schedule is probably the best way to achieve that goal.
Health-care recommendations for people to spend time in nature are probably years away, but the movement has begun. Several organizations around the world are working to promote awareness of nature’s contribution to health. Some researchers have used the term “a dose of nature” to evaluate the amount of exposure needed to gain benefits. “That was kind of the deliberate medicalization of the language around nature and health,” says White.

6 . Facial expressions carry meaning that is determined by situations and relationships. For example, in American culture (文化) the smile is in general an expression of pleasure. Yet it also has other uses. A woman’s smile at a police officer does not carry the same meaning as the smile she gives to a young child. A smile may show love or politeness. It can also hide true feelings. It often causes confusion (困惑) across cultures. For example, many people in Russia consider smiling at strangers in public to be unusual and even improper. Yet many Americans smile freely at strangers in public places (although this is less common in big cities).Some Russians believe that Americans smile in the wrong places; some Americans believe that Russians don’t smile enough. In Southeast Asian cultures, a smile is frequently used to cover painful feelings. Vietnamese people may tell a sad story but end the story with a smile.
Our faces show emotions (情感), but we should not attempt to "read" people from another culture as we would "read" someone from our own culture. The fact that members of one culture do not express their emotions as openly as do members of another does not mean that they do not experience emotions.
Rather, there are cultural differences in the amount of facial expressions permitted. For example, in public and in formal situations many Japanese do not show their emotions as freely as Americans do. When with friends, Japanese and Americans seem to show their emotions similarly.
It is difficult to generalize about Americans and facial expressiveness because of personal and cultural differences in the United States. People from certain cultural backgrounds in the United States seem to be more facially expressive than others. The key is to try not to judge people whose ways of showing emotion are different. If we judge according to our own cultural habits, we may make the mistake of "reading" the other person incorrectly.
